YOUR ROLE
The Associate operations analyst liaises between the IT teams and the supply chain, and acts as the first point of contact for system and process related issues.
This analyst works closely with the DC operations, inventory management and IT teams to successfully resolve issues and ensure a smooth flow of operations at the Aldo Group.
With a strong understanding of supply chain and warehouse management processes, this analyst will support the operations teams by deep-diving into issues, finding a resolution, providing training on how to resolve each issue in case of a process gap, and by working with the associated team to revise the process and/or enhance the system to avoid or minimize the issue in the future.
DO YOU HAVE THE PROFILE WE'RE LOOKING FOR?
THE RESPONSIBILITIES :
- Ensure accuracy and integrity of data by analyzing internal and external reports and escalating or resolving discrepancies in case of misalignment.
- Timely and efficiently resolve idoc failures from our 3PLs by coordinating with internal and external support teams.
- Support the operations teams with improving their processes or requesting an IT enhancement when there is a process gap or system issue that is contributing to or exacerbating the number of idoc failures.
- Understand system integrations between SAP FMS/ECC and the WMS (EWM & 3PL WMS) and business applications (ARUN, MRP, Inventory Adjustments & DC Floor Operations) related to the idocs monitored.
- Document and create process guides detailing various issues and create a decision tree for how to resolve each type of issue.
- Escalate and transfer issues to the IT team for further analysis if the issue cannot be solved by the operations analyst. Monitor and track the progress of the ticket, and provide updates to the operations team if needed.- Work with internal teams to build and test exception management dashboards.
- Document all exception management dashboards and RACI used per leg of the supply chain.
- Act as a control tower to monitor key exceptions in collaboration with the rest of the supply chain team.

About ALDO Group
Founded in 1972, the ALDO Group is one of the world’s leading fashion retailers. We specialize in the design and production of quality, stylish and accessible footwear and accessories.
From our global head office based in Montreal, we operate a network of over 1,500 stores worldwide under our three signature banners: ALDO, Call It Spring and GLOBO.
Guided by a strong set of values and aiming to influence society in both fashion and social responsibility, our purpose is to create a world of love, confidence, and belonging.
We are advocates for diversity and inclusion, and for the environment. In 2018, we were the first fashion footwear and accessories company in the world to be certified climate neutral and we carry forward our sustainability journey.
